1. 她连水都不愿喝一口,更别提留下来吃饭了。(much less)
Suggested answer: She wouldn't take a drink, much less would she stay for dinner.
2. 他认为我在对他说谎,但实际上我讲的是实话。(whereas)
Suggested answer: He thought I was lying to him, whereas I was telling the truth.
3. 这个星期你每天都迟到,对此你怎么解释? (account for)
Suggested answer: How do you account for the fact that you have been late every day
this week?
4. 他们利润增长的部分原因是采用了新的市场策略。(due to)
Suggested answer: The increase in their profits is due partly to their new market strategy.
5. 这样的措施很可能会带来工作效率的提高。(result in)
Suggested answer: Such measures are likely to result in the improvement of work
efficiency.
6. 我们已经在这个项目上投入了大量时间和精力,所以我们只能继续。(pour into)
Suggested answer: We have already poured a lot of time and energy into the project, so
we have to carry on.
1. 尽管她是家里的独生女,她父母也从不溺爱她。(despite)
Suggested answer: Despite the fact that she is the only child in her family, she is never
babied by her parents.
2. 迈克没来参加昨晚的聚会,也没给我打电话作任何解释。(nor)
Suggested answer: Mike didn't come to the party last night, nor did he call me to give an
explanation.
3. 坐在他旁边的那个人确实发表过一些小说,但决不是什么大作家。(next to; by no means)
Suggested answer: The person sitting next to him did publish some novels, but he is by no
means a great writer.
4. 他对足球不感兴趣,也从不关心谁输谁赢。(be indifferent to)
Suggested answer: He has no interest in football and is indifferent to who wins or loses.
5. 经理需要一个可以信赖的助手,在他外出时,由助手负责处理问题。(count on)
Suggested answer: The manager needs an assistant that he can count on to take care of
problems in his absence.
6. 这是他第一次当着那么多观众演讲。(in the presence of sb.)
Suggested answer: This is the first time that he has made a speech in the presence of so
large an audience.
1. 你再怎么有经验,也得学习新技术。(never too... to...)
Suggested answer: You are never too experienced to learn new techniques.
2. 还存在一个问题,那就是派谁去带领那里的研究工作。(Use an appositional structure)
Suggested answer: There remains one problem, namely, who should be sent to head the
research there.
3. 由于文化的不同,他们的关系在开始确实遇到了一些困难。(meet with) Suggested answer: Their relationship did meet with some difficulty at the beginning
because of cultural differences.
4. 虽然他历经沉浮,但我始终相信他总有一天会成功的。(ups and downs; all along)
Suggested answer: Though he has had ups and downs, I believed all along that he would
succeed someday.
5. 我对你的说法的真实性有些保留看法。(have reservations about)
Suggested answer: I have some reservations about the truth of your claim.
6. 她长得并不特别高,但是她身材瘦,给人一种个子高的错觉。(give an illusion of)
Suggested answer: She isn't particularly tall, but her slim figure gives an illusion of height.
1. 有朋自远方来,不亦乐乎? (Use "it" as the formal subject)
Suggested answer: It is a great pleasure to meet friends from afar.
2. 不管黑猫白猫,能抓住老鼠就是好猫。(as long as)
Suggested answer: It doesn't matter whether the cat is black or white as long as it catches
mice.
3. 你必须明天上午十点之前把那笔钱还给我。(without fail)
Suggested answer: You must let me have the money back without fail by ten o'clock
tomorrow morning.
4. 请允许我参加这个项目,我对这个项目非常感兴趣。(more than + adjective)
Suggested answer: Allow me to take part in this project: I am more than a little interested
in it.
5. 人人都知道他比较特殊:他来去随意。 (be free to do sth.)
Suggested answer: Everyone knows that he is special: He is free to come and go as he
pleases.
6. 看她脸上不悦的神色,我觉得她似乎有什么话想跟我说。(feel as though)
Suggested answer: Watching the unhappy look on her face, I felt as though she wished to
say something to me.
1. 他说话很自信,给我留下了很深的印象。(Use "which" to refer back to an idea or
situation)
Suggested answer: He spoke confidently, which impressed me most.
2. 我父亲太爱忘事,总是在找钥匙。 (Use "so... that..." to emphasize the degree of
something)
Suggested answer: My father is so forgetful that he is always looking for his keys.
3. 我十分感激你给我的帮助。(be grateful for)
Suggested answer: I'm very grateful to you for all the help you have given me.
4. 光线不足,加上地面潮湿,使得驾驶十分困难。(coupled with)
Suggested answer: The bad light, coupled with the wet ground, made driving very difficult.
5. 由于缺乏资金,他们不得不取消了创业计划。(starve of)
Suggested answer: Being starved of funds, they had to cancel their plan to start a business.
6. 每当有了麻烦,他们总是依靠我们。(lean on)
Suggested answer: They always lean on us whenever they are in trouble.
1. 就像机器需要经常运转一样,身体也需要经常锻炼。(as... so...)
Suggested answer: (Just) as a machine needs regular running, so does the body need
regular exercise.
2. 在美国学习时,他学会了弹钢琴。(while + V-ing)
Suggested answer: He learned to play the piano while studying in the United States.
3. 令我们失望的是,他拒绝了我们的邀请。(turn down)
Suggested answer: To our disappointment, he turned down our invitation.
4. 真实情况是,不管是好是坏,随着新科技的进步,世界发生了变化。(for better or worse)
Suggested answer: The reality is that, for better or worse, the world has changed with the
advance of new technologies.
5. 我班里的大多数女生在被要求回答问题时都似乎感到不自在。(ill at ease)
Suggested answer: Most of the female students in my class appear to be ill at ease when
(they are) required to answer questions.
6. 当地政府负责运动会的安全。(take charge of)
Suggested answer: The local government took charge of the security for the sports
meeting.
1. 在会上,除了其他事情,他们还讨论了目前的经济形势。(among other things)
Suggested answer: At the meeting they discussed, among other things, the present
economic situation.
2. 我对大自然了解得越多,就越痴迷于大自然的奥秘。(the more... the more...)
Suggested answer: The more I learned about the nature, the more absorbed I became in
its mystery.
3. 医生建议说,有压力的人要学会做一些新鲜有趣、富有挑战性的事情,好让自己的负面情绪有发泄的渠道。(recommend that... should...)
Suggested answer: The doctor recommends that those stressed people should try
something new, interesting and challenging in order to give their negative feelings an
outlet.
4. 那个学生的成绩差,但老师给他布置了更多的作业,而不是减少作业量。(instead of; cut
down)
Suggested answer: The teacher gives more homework to the student who has bad grades
instead of cutting it down.
5. 相比之下,美国的父母更趋向于把孩子的成功归因于天赋。(attribute to)
Suggested answer: By contrast, American parents are more likely to attribute their
children's success to natural talent.
